Skip to main content
a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orAlexander Kurtakov2016-01-07 08:38:50 +0000
committerSopot Cela2016-01-07 11:48:51 +0000
commit7c1e1bb7b124146583832f39e1a535bcbbaf2571 (patch)
tree08c645aac79b643416eb8a16e54dd4d418b79eaa
parente54b01330f33d94bb5d11a147111f574a5a8f0ba (diff)
downloadeclipse.platform.ui-7c1e1bb7b124146583832f39e1a535bcbbaf2571.tar.gz
eclipse.platform.ui-7c1e1bb7b124146583832f39e1a535bcbbaf2571.tar.xz
eclipse.platform.ui-7c1e1bb7b124146583832f39e1a535bcbbaf2571.zip
Bug 485320 - Don't ignore unavoidableGenericProblems in
o.e.ui.navigator.resources Enable the compiler warning and fix the 3 warnings. Change-Id: I99549d91f85fbb9c1f5657f482019c31ce3cea12 Signed-off-by: Alexander Kurtakov <akurtako@redhat.com>
-rw-r--r--bundles/org.eclipse.ui.navigator.resources/.settings/org.eclipse.jdt.core.prefs2
-rw-r--r--b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/actions/PortingActionProvider.java3
-rw-r--r--b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/actions/ResourceMgmtActionProvider.java2
-rw-r--r--b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/plugin/NavigatorUIPluginImages.java3
4 files changed, 6 insertions, 4 deletions
diff --git a/bundles/org.eclipse.ui.navigator.resources/.settings/org.eclipse.jdt.core.prefs b/bundles/org.eclipse.ui.navigator.resources/.settings/org.eclipse.jdt.core.prefs
index 4cae5d8ab11..b6f3b6050f8 100644
--- a/bundles/org.eclipse.ui.navigator.resources/.settings/org.eclipse.jdt.core.prefs
+++ b/bundles/org.eclipse.ui.navigator.resources/.settings/org.eclipse.jdt.core.prefs
@@ -94,7 +94,7 @@ org.eclipse.jdt.core.compiler.problem.suppressWarnings=enabled
org.eclipse.jdt.core.compiler.problem.syntacticNullAnalysisForFields=disabled
org.eclipse.jdt.core.compiler.problem.syntheticAccessEmulation=ignore
org.eclipse.jdt.core.compiler.problem.typeParameterHiding=warning
-org.eclipse.jdt.core.compiler.problem.unavoidableGenericTypeProblems=disabled
+org.eclipse.jdt.core.compiler.problem.unavoidableGenericTypeProblems=enabled
org.eclipse.jdt.core.compiler.problem.uncheckedTypeOperation=warning
org.eclipse.jdt.core.compiler.problem.unclosedCloseable=warning
org.eclipse.jdt.core.compiler.problem.undocumentedEmptyBlock=ignore
diff --git a/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/actions/PortingActionProvider.java b/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/actions/PortingActionProvider.java
index 08084d8df1a..72451865dc2 100644
--- a/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/actions/PortingActionProvider.java
+++ b/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/actions/PortingActionProvider.java
@@ -128,7 +128,8 @@ public class PortingActionProvider extends CommonActionProvider {
*/
protected ImageDescriptor getImageDescriptor(String relativePath) {
String iconPath = "icons/full/"; //$NON-NLS-1$
- URL url = FileLocator.find(WorkbenchNavigatorPlugin.getDefault().getBundle(), new Path(iconPath + relativePath), Collections.EMPTY_MAP);
+ URL url = FileLocator.find(WorkbenchNavigatorPlugin.getDefault().getBundle(), new Path(iconPath + relativePath),
+ Collections.<String, String> emptyMap());
if (url == null) {
return ImageDescriptor.getMissingImageDescriptor();
}
diff --git a/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/actions/ResourceMgmtActionProvider.java b/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/actions/ResourceMgmtActionProvider.java
index 2b03331b7e0..8059f332a33 100644
--- a/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/actions/ResourceMgmtActionProvider.java
+++ b/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/actions/ResourceMgmtActionProvider.java
@@ -112,7 +112,7 @@ public class ResourceMgmtActionProvider extends CommonActionProvider {
boolean hasClosedProjects = false;
boolean hasBuilder = true; // false if any project is closed or does not
// have builder
- Iterator<Object> resources = selection.iterator();
+ Iterator<?> resources = selection.iterator();
while (resources.hasNext() && (!hasOpenProjects || !hasClosedProjects || hasBuilder || isProjectSelection)) {
Object next = resources.next();
diff --git a/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/plugin/NavigatorUIPluginImages.java b/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/plugin/NavigatorUIPluginImages.java
index 16f018c356a..6d4bf82a6d0 100644
--- a/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/plugin/NavigatorUIPluginImages.java
+++ b/bundles/org.eclipse.ui.navigator.resources/src/org/eclipse/ui/internal/navigator/resources/plugin/NavigatorUIPluginImages.java
@@ -44,7 +44,8 @@ public class NavigatorUIPluginImages {
// Create the icon location
static {
String pathSuffix = "icons/full/"; //$NON-NLS-1$
- fgIconLocation = FileLocator.find(NavigatorPlugin.getDefault().getBundle(), new Path(pathSuffix), Collections.EMPTY_MAP);
+ fgIconLocation = FileLocator.find(NavigatorPlugin.getDefault().getBundle(), new Path(pathSuffix),
+ Collections.<String, String> emptyMap());
}
/**

Back to the top